Our verdict is Benign. The variant received -11 ACMG points: 2P and 13B. PM2BP4_StrongBP6_Very_StrongBP7
The NM_001035.3(RYR2):c.3567A>G(p.Glu1189Glu)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Glu1189Glu in exon 29 of RYR2: This variant is not expected to have clinical sig nificance because it does not alter an amino acid residue and is not located wit hin the splice consensus sequence. It has been identified in 1/6814 European Ame rican chromosomes from a broad population by the NHLBI Exome Sequencing Project (http://evs.gs.washington.edu/EVS).
